ENG 380 - PROFESSIONALIZATION SEMINAR

Institution:
Kutztown University of Pennsylvania
Subject:
English
Description:
This course will provide students with the tools they need to make the transition from undergraduate academic study to professional application of skills, apply for and obtain internships, and identify and work towards specific post-graduation goals. Students will learn about internship and professional opportunities for English and Professional Writing majors, create professional resumes and cover letters, complete effective social media profiles, create a professional website, network with professionals, and apply for and obtain internships. Students will be required to update the professional website during the internship to include work done during this experience. This is a required course for all undergraduate English and Professional Writing majors and should be taken prior to the for-credit internship experience.
